What public transport options serve the Girrawheen area?
The suburb is served by several Transperth bus routes, including the 389 along Wanneroo Road, the 375 and 448 on Beach Road, and routes such as 374, 386 and the high‑frequency 970 along Mirrabooka Avenue, providing links to Perth, Warwick and surrounding suburbs.
What does the name “Girrawheen” mean?
Girrawheen means “place of flowers” or “the place where flowers grow” in an Eastern States Aboriginal language.
